‌The Feature Story: The People of Yarlung Celebrates the Grand Cycling Event

2025-08-14 16:46:00China Tibet Online

In August, Shannan, Xizang bathed in golden sunlight, with splendors unfolding across its landscape. The people of Yarlung joyfully laughed, sang, and danced as they celebrated the opening ceremony of the second stage of the Sixth China Xizang Trans-Himalaya International Cycling Race in 2025. They extended a warm welcome to guests from around the world.

During the competition, the residents gathered on both sides of the road, donning traditional costumes representative of Shannan. Some held white hada scarves in their hands, while others raised the Five-starred Red Flag. Additionally, some displayed the vibrant pulu(woolen fabric) made in Shannan, and others rode horses, enthusiastically cheering for the competitors as they passed by.

Jiaoqiong, a 53-year-old villager from Kena Village in Cuosheloma Town, Co Nyi County, Xizang, is one of the beneficiaries of the ecological relocation policy implemented in the region. In 2021, he relocated from Co Nyi County in Nagqu City, situated at an average altitude of approximately 5,000 meters, to Senburi Village, where he began to enjoy a more convenient and modern lifestyle. On that day, upon learning that the finish line of the cycling race was located right at his doorstep, Jiaoqiong and his fellow villagers thronged early to await the competitors. They even donned traditional Tibetan costumes to cheer for them enthusiastically.
